One Wish

I gazed into the star strewn sky,
As something glimmered and caught my eye.

A star shot off into space,
A thought-filled look spread across my face.

"What should I wish for?" I wondered aloud.
The answer still I haven't found.

Perhaps this is because there's nothing more,
That I could possibly wish for.

I have my friends, my family,
My grades are good from what I see.

There are those little things that make my day bright,
But no wishes for me; I'm alright.
